CDN边缘节点如何优化网络性能并减少延迟?

CDN边缘节点是内容分发网络(Content Delivery Network)的关键组成部分,位于网络的边缘,靠近最终用户。这些节点缓存数据以减少延迟,提高数据传输速度和网站性能,确保用户能够快速可靠地访问在线内容。

关于CDN边缘节点的详细介绍,以下是对它们的各个方面的深入分析:

cdn边缘节点
(图片来源网络,侵删)

CDN边缘节点是CDN(内容分发网络)的关键组件,它们分布在全球不同地区,负责将网站内容缓存到离用户更近的位置,以此提高用户访问速度和网站的可用性,CDN边缘节点由CDN服务提供商提供,其数量和地理分布直接影响服务的性能。

1、性能优化

加速访问速度:通过将内容缓存到离用户最近的服务器上,减少网络延迟和带宽占用。

提高网站可用性:在主服务器出现问题时,自动切换到备用服务器,保证用户能够正常访问网站。

降低服务器负载:减轻主服务器的负载,提高网站性能和可靠性。

2、文件缓存机制

静态文件缓存:缓存如图片、视频、CSS、JavaScript等不常变动的静态文件,提升访问速度和可用性。

cdn边缘节点
(图片来源网络,侵删)

动态文件缓存:缓存如HTML页面、PHP页面等频繁变动的动态文件,通过设置缓存时间和规则控制缓存。

在线文件缓存:缓存如在线音乐、在线视频等需要实时获取的文件,同样通过设置缓存时间和规则进行控制。

3、缓存规则设置

缓存时间调整:根据文件类型和变动频率,设置不同的缓存时间,以达到最优的缓存效果。

缓存规则定制:为不同类型的文件设置不同的缓存规则,确保缓存效率和效果。

4、网络流量与成本优化

节约带宽成本:通过缓存减少从源服务器到用户的数据传输量,降低网络流量成本。

cdn边缘节点
(图片来源网络,侵删)

高可用性与容错能力:即使某个节点发生故障,仍能从其他节点获取内容,提供高可用性。

5、负载压力缓解

减轻源站负载:CDN承担静态资源的缓存和传输,使源站能专注处理动态内容和数据。

6、用户体验提升

减少网络延迟:通过最近的边缘节点快速响应用户请求,改善用户体验。

7、分发

全球节点分布:CDN服务提供商通常在全球范围内部署多个边缘节点,确保内容的快速分发和获取。

8、应用场景多样性

多领域应用:CDN服务不仅限于网站加速,还广泛应用于移动应用、视频流媒体等领域。

9、关系与区别

与边缘计算的关系:边缘计算更注重在靠近用户端进行数据处理和存储,而CDN焦点在于内容分发和缓存。

功能区别:尽管边缘计算和CDN都旨在减少延迟和中心化压力,但CDN更专注于内容传递,边缘计算则包含更广泛的处理功能。

在考虑使用CDN服务时,建议关注以下几点:

选择信誉良好的CDN服务提供商,确保节点的稳定性和可靠性。

根据网站或应用的实际需求,合理设置缓存规则和时间,以优化性能。

监控CDN服务的效果,定期调整配置以应对流量变化和优化用户体验。

CDN边缘节点是提升互联网性能的关键设施,它们通过智能分发和缓存机制,优化了数据的传输路径,减少了延迟,提高了网站的响应速度和可用性,在选择合适的CDN服务提供商时,企业应考虑节点的数量、地理位置、以及服务的稳定性和成本效益,通过合理的配置和管理,CDN边缘节点可以显著提升用户体验,减轻源服务器的负载,并节省带宽成本,随着互联网技术和应用的不断演进,CDN边缘节点的作用将更加凸显,成为支撑数字化时代的重要组成部分。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/840287.html

(0)
未希的头像未希新媒体运营
上一篇 2024-08-04 14:27
下一篇 2024-08-04 14:29

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入